AI summary

The company submitted its unaudited financial results for Q1 FY26, approved by the Board on 12 August 2025. Revenue from operations rose to ₹194.32 lakhs from ₹159.26 lakhs in Q1 FY25, a growth of about 22%, driven mainly by the trading segment (₹43.18 lakhs vs ₹23.01 lakhs) and investments (₹94.91 lakhs vs ₹82.74 lakhs). However, total expenses jumped sharply to ₹101.50 lakhs from ₹64.15 lakhs due to higher purchase costs and other expenses. Profit before tax was nearly flat at ₹104.32 lakhs versus ₹106.53 lakhs, while profit after tax fell to ₹77.07 lakhs from ₹114.20 lakhs (a drop of about 32%) on higher tax outflow. EPS for the quarter stood at ₹11.34 versus ₹16.81 in the year-ago period. The auditor M/s Desai Saksena & Associates issued a clean (unmodified) limited review report, and noted that the prior-year comparative figures were reviewed by the predecessor auditor.
